C++ - Удаленные функции (С++ 11) Что будет выведено на экран? | ProgHub
Удаленные функции (С++ 11) Что будет выведено на экран?
#include <iostream> 
using namespace std; 
 
void func( int number)  
{ 
   cout << "hello" << endl; 
} 
 
void func(char number) = delete; 
void func(double number) = delete; 
 
 
int main() 
{ 
   func( 4); 
   func( 'c'); 
   func( true); 
   func( 3.14); 
 
   return 0; 
}
hello
hello
hello
hello
hello
hello
hello
hello
hello
hello
произойдет ошибка компиляции